2016-02-19 8 views
7

हमें हमारे कुछ उपयोगकर्ताओं के लिए यह अजीब त्रुटि मिल रही है जो वेब साइट के भीतर मोबाइल से OAuth2 API में लिंक के माध्यम से प्रमाणित करने का प्रयास कर रहे हैं।LinkedIn OAuth2 प्रमाणीकरण सर्वर को एक अप्रत्याशित स्थिति का सामना करना पड़ा

https://www.linkedin.com/uas/oauth2/authorization?response_type=code&client_id=XXX&state=XXX&redirect_uri=XXX&scope=r_emailaddress%20r_basicprofile 

प्रस्तुत (https://www.linkedin.com/uas/oauth2/authorizedialog/submit) के बाद, वहाँ निम्नलिखित पैरामीटर के साथ हमारे रीडायरेक्ट uri को कोई रीडायरेक्ट है।

?error=server_error&error_description=XXX&state=the+authorization+server+encountered+an+unexpected+condition 

मैं इस =>http://chriskief.com/2014/04/23/linkedin-api-unable-to-retrieve-access-token/ के माध्यम से चला गया।

नया एप्लिकेशन बनाना या ताजा चाबियाँ बनाना एक समस्या है क्योंकि यह पहले से इंस्टॉल किए गए ऐप्स के लिए लॉगिन में लिंक को तोड़ देगा। हमने पहले कभी OAuth1 का उपयोग नहीं किया है।

+1

मुझे यह भी मिल रहा है - खासकर मोबाइल उपयोगकर्ताओं के लिए। क्या आपको कोई और अंतर्दृष्टि मिली? –

+0

मुझे यह भी मिल रहा है, खासकर मोबाइल उपयोगकर्ताओं के लिए। हमने एक बार बग को पुन: पेश करने में कामयाब रहे: यह केवल एक खाते और केवल मोबाइल (एंड्रॉइड क्रोम, आईफोन सफारी, और आईफोन क्रोम) पर बगैर हुआ लेकिन यह डेस्कटॉप (ओएसएक्स सफारी और ओएसएक्स क्रोम) पर काम करता था। उसी डिवाइस पर अन्य खातों के साथ सब ठीक काम किया। परीक्षण के 15 मिनट के बाद यह फिर से काम किया ... –

+0

क्या आप इसे ठीक करने के लिए प्रबंधन किया था? – jony89

उत्तर

0

मुझे यह सही समस्या थी। मेरे मामले में, समस्या यह थी कि मैं डिफ़ॉल्ट प्राधिकरण स्कोप ओवरराइड कर रहा था (का उपयोग कर? Scope = ..)। मुझे यकीन नहीं है कि इससे समस्या क्यों हुई, या यह हमेशा मोबाइल उपयोगकर्ताओं के साथ क्यों हुआ। लेकिन ओवरराइड को हटाकर इसे दूर कर दिया गया।

2

हम इस त्रुटि को पुन: उत्पन्न करने में सक्षम थे जब किसी स्पेस कैरेक्टर को लिंक किए गए प्राधिकरण फ़ॉर्म पर उपयोगकर्ता के ईमेल पते से पहले या उसके बाद जोड़ा जाता है। लिंक्डइन इस क्षेत्र में अपर्याप्त व्हाइटस्पेस की कोई भी कमी नहीं करता है।

मेरी परिकल्पना यह है कि यह मोबाइल पर होता है जब लोग स्पेस बार का उपयोग ईमेल पते पर स्वत: पूर्णता अनुशंसा स्वीकार करने के तरीके के रूप में करते हैं। तो उपयोगकर्ता अपना ईमेल पता लिखना शुरू कर देता है, ओएस एक ज्ञात ईमेल पता की सिफारिश करता है और, आमतौर पर, मोबाइल ओएस स्पेस बार दबाए जाने पर सिफारिश का उपयोग करेगा।

+0

यूप, जो मेरे लिए भी त्रुटि का कारण बनता है। – jony89

+0

मैंने लिंकडिन को एक बग की रिपोर्ट करने का प्रयास किया है, हालांकि ऐसा करने के लिए कहीं भी नहीं मिला। क्या आपको कोई विचार है कि यह कहां संभव है? (http://stackoverflow.com/questions/42247529/linkedin-bug- रिपोर्टिंग भी देखें) – jony89

+0

हाँ, मुझे यह भी सामना करना पड़ा। ईमेल के बाद यह जगह थी। – Isuru

संबंधित मुद्दे

 संबंधित मुद्दे